Ruth Bryant Hodge, 79, passed away Friday, December 24, 2010, at St. Joseph's Hospital in Atlanta, GA, following a short illness. Born October 17, 1931, in Pacolet, SC, she was a daughter of the late Furman Bryant and Maybelle Bryant Fowler. She graduated from Pacolet High School and Cecil's Business College, and was employed with First Federal Savings & Loan Association and Grier and Co. in Spartanburg, SC. She and her husband resided in Hazelhurst and Dalton, GA before settling in Marietta, GA for the past 37 years. Ruth and her husband were members of the Atlanta Country Club for many years, where they enjoyed many fun activities and friendships. She also enjoyed golf in previous years, travel abroad, and cross-country travel with friends and family. Oil painting was also a favorite passion. Ruth will be remembered for her immense love for her family and close friends, and a sense of humor that was enjoyed by all who were honored to be a part of her very special life.
